One Day Workshop
Our One Day Workshop offers amateur dancers and their teachers an unparalleled overall experience around a Danshuis Station Zuid performance. Our ballet master and dancers will come to the participating organisation’s accommodation, e.g. dance schools, ballet schools, educational institutions or creative centres. The day will start with a technical class. This will be a warming up for the muscles, and the distinctive combinations of movements will create a wonderful dance flow that will focus concentration and physical alertness. This lesson will segue into a workshop in which the amateurs will set to work on parts of the repertoire from the performance in question.
In the artists’ shoes
Through short composition-assignments
participants will step into the artists’ shoes to explore how they
could change, expand, or refine the dance material. Then they will
present the results to each other. After so much hard work there is
time for a little breather during a thematic lecture that will focus
completely on the performance they will see later on in the day.
Backstage Tour
This
concludes the active part of the One Day Workshop after which the
participants will move on and go to the theatre where they will receive
a backstage tour. They will be able to see the dancers perform their
final preparations: stretching their bodies, warming up the muscles and
going over the steps one more time. Next, as the rest of the audience
walks in, they will take the seats that have been reserved for them;
cue lights! From the first movement and the opening sounds they will
recognize the dancers’ concentration, their complete surrender until
the curtain falls, an experience they have after all shared for the
whole day. To be so completely involved in a performance will give the
participating amateurs and their teachers an unparalleled and
creatively inspiring dance experience.
